Route 53 とは?用途やメリットを分かりやすく解説
AWSの高機能DNSサービス「Route 53」について、ドメイン取得からヘルスチェック・トラフィックルーティングまで解説。
Route 53とは?
Route 53は、AWSが提供する可用性と拡張性に優れたクラウドDNS(ドメインネームシステム)ウェブサービスです。「53」はDNSで使用されるTCP/UDPのポート番号に由来しています。ドメインの登録と、IPアドレスとドメイン名を結びつける名前解決(DNSルーティング)の両方を行うことができます。
主な役割とメリット
Route 53の最大のメリットは「100%の可用性 SLA(サービス水準合意)」を保証している点です。DNSがダウンするとシステム全体がアクセス不能になるため、この100%保証はインフラにとって非常に重要です。また、単なる名前解決だけでなく、ユーザーの地理的場所やサーバーの健康状態(ヘルスチェック)に応じた高度なルーティング(振り分け)が可能です。
どのような場面で使われるか
自社サービスの独自ドメイン(例: example.com)を取得し、それをAWS上のサーバー(ALBやEC2)に紐付けて公開する際の中核として使用します。
関連するAWSサービスとの組み合わせ例
- Route 53 + ALB + ACM: 独自ドメイン宛のアクセスをALBに流し、ACMで発行したSSL証明書を使って安全なHTTPS通信を確立します。
- Route 53 + CloudFront + S3: S3にホスティングした静的サイトを、CloudFront経由で独自ドメインとして高速配信します(Aliasレコードを使用)。
実務上の注意点
Route 53で取得したドメインの更新忘れによるサイト停止事故は意外と少なくありません。自動更新設定が有効になっているかを必ず確認してください。
よくあるエラーやトラブルシュート
- 名前解決ができない(サイトが見つからない): ドメインのネームサーバー(NSレコード)が正しくRoute 53に向けられていない、またはレコード設定の反映(プロパゲーション)に時間がかかっているケースが考えられます。
まとめ
Route 53はAWS上のサービスと外部インターネットを繋ぐ「入り口の案内板」です。特に「Alias(エイリアス)レコード」を用いることで、IPアドレスが動的に変わるALBなどのAWSリソースに対して直接ドメインを紐付けることができるため、AWS環境では必須のサービスです。
関連する用語 (cloud)
全16件を見るALB (Application Load Balancer) とは?用途やメリットを分かりやすく解説
インフラの負荷分散に欠かせないAWSの「ALB(ELB)」について、ルーティングルールからスケール時の構成例まで丁寧に解説。
CloudFront とは?用途やメリットを分かりやすく解説
AWSのCDN(コンテンツ配信ネットワーク)サービス「CloudFront」について、Webサイトの高速化と負荷分散の実務活用例を解説。
RDS (Relational Database Service) とは?用途やメリットを分かりやすく解説
AWSが提供するマネージドリレーショナルデータベース「RDS」について、運用負荷を減らす機能からマルチAZ構成まで解説。
EC2 (Elastic Compute Cloud) とは?用途やメリットを分かりやすく解説
AWSの仮想サーバーサービス「EC2」について、初心者でも理解できるように基礎から実務でのユースケースまで徹底解説します。
IAM (Identity and Access Management) とは?用途やメリットを分かりやすく解説
AWSのセキュリティの要である「IAM」について、ユーザーやロールの概念から最小権限の原則といった実務ノウハウまで解説。
Lambda (AWS Lambda) とは?用途やメリットを分かりやすく解説
サーバーレスアーキテクチャの代名詞「AWS Lambda」について、イベント駆動型のプログラム実行から実務での活用法まで解説。